Aviation/Airway Management & Operations is the 362nd most popular major in the country with 1,895 degrees awarded in 2020-2021.
Across Tennessee, there were 14 aviation/airway management and operations gra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$0 respectively. At the master’s degree level specifically, there were 14 aviation/airway management and operations graduates with average earnings and debt of $56,060 and $0 respectively.
To top this list, a school must have a successful aviation/airway management and operations program that graduates more students in the field than other colleges that offer the same major.
